About the Course

Learn Laser Cutting & 3D Printing by Building a Custom Shadow Lamp

In this 6-part Maker Series, you’ll design and build a fully custom shadow projection lamp from concept to completion –  combining laser cutting, 3D printing, and digital design into one cohesive project. Learn Adobe Illustrator workflows, laser cut precise components, and 3D print a lithophane (a special image that glows when backlit) from your favorite photo. By the end, you’ll walk away with a fully functional, personalized shadow projection lamp, a portfolio-ready project, the ability to integrate 2D + 3D fabrication workflows, and the confidence to design your next custom product or art piece. All lamp materials are included. Some outside-class independent work is expected.

What You’ll Learn:

  • Design precision-cut lamp components in Adobe Illustrator
  • Laser cutting techniques with acrylic and plywood
  • 3D primitives with 2D Materials and create a custom lithophane from your own photo
  • 3D print functional and decorative elements
  • Prototype, refine, and professionally finish your piece
  • Digital fabrication workflow from concept to completion

NextFab’s Maker Series is a two-month program that gives you up to 5 classes, unlimited shop access, and a cohort to learn alongside. 

Q. What is included in the Maker Series package?

A. Registration in a Maker Series grants you:

  • The scheduled classes and training to complete the selected project (over $600 of class instruction)
  • 2 months of active NextFab Membership, starting on the first class date (over $298 value)
  • Special member pricing to continue membership beyond the 2 months: $129/month (over 10% discount from standard membership)
  • A cohort of peers, new skills and confidence gained, and a sense of community within the Philadelphia creative ecosystem (priceless value!)

Q: If I am a previous member of NextFab, can I join the Maker Series?

A: Absolutely! If you are a previous member and looking to complete the class project or get a major refresh of skills you haven’t used for a while, the Maker Series is a perfect way to get your feet wet again. To receive the discounted pricing for members, please register through our Q-Reserve system available on our Member Portal.

Q: I have a schedule conflict with one of the class dates. Can I make it up?

A: While we understand things can occasionally come up, please do your best to stick to the scheduled dates. Participants in the Maker Series will be charged a rate of $60 per hour for any required make-up sessions. Your instructor will work with you to arrange a make-up session based on their availability. To ensure you remain on track with the program’s objectives, please provide as much advance notice as possible if a make-up session is needed.

Q: Should I join the Maker Series or join as a regular member and take classes?

A: This depends on your goals. If you are feeling inspired and want to learn new skills but don’t have a particular project in mind, the Maker Series is perfectly suited to get your feet wet and help you find your way in the craft.

If you have a particular project in mind and want to learn all the skills needed and complete your specific project, our membership plus a credit package ($249/mo) is your golden ticket. Our regular membership ($149/month) plus our education credit package ($100/month) comes with $200 worth of class credits monthly, so you can get started taking the classes you need on your schedule. You can even book Private Training sessions with those credits if you need hands-on help completing your project.
